Flout 1100 Words You Need Flout 1100 Words You Need /flaʊt/ (verb) to intentionally disobey a rule, law, or custom, defy, openly ignore laws or conventions, break rules, contravene, be in breach of, spurn, scoff: Many motorcyclists flout the law by not wearing helmets. The orchestra decided to flout convention/tradition, and wear their everyday clothes for the concert. Antonyms obey, abide by, comply with, conform to Parts of Speech Adverb: floutingly Noun: flouter
